On Thursday, October 2, 2014 3:51:38 AM UTC-4, Nicola Gigante wrote:
>
>
> In my opinion this is a very useful feature! A lot of times I=E2=80=99ve =
wanted to=20
> use bitset but I couldn=E2=80=99t because
> I also needed to directly access the underlying data. I think this is a=
=20
> fundamental flaw in the current std::bitset
> design. I=E2=80=99d farther suggest to make it simple to tie a bitset to =
an=20
> already existing buffer. Would it be difficult
> to standardize a =E2=80=9Cbitset_view=E2=80=9D class that just adapts an =
existing random=20
> access container and expose the
> bit access capabilities of bitset?=20
>

Its possible. As you pointed out bitset_view would need to be a separate=20
class.
=20

> Then the old bitset could be implemented by wrapping this view over
> a std::array, while wrapping over an array_view would make it possible to=
=20
> access already existing buffers.
>

It depends on how bitset_view is implemented. If its implemented on top of=
=20
array_view (which I would recommend), this is a non-starter because the=20
object would contain 2 extra pointers. Defeating the entire purpose of my=
=20
current proposal.
=20

> Wrapping it over an std::vector, we=E2=80=99ll have boost::dynamic_bitset=
 for free.
>

Well not quite, a hypothetical bitset_view I imagine would work like=20
array_view in that it just wraps over a pair or pointers and gives you a=20
bit access API over the buffer. In fact I'd probably define such a=20
bitset_view to just accept an array_view in its constructor so that it can=
=20
generically wrap any kind of buffer by piggybacking off of array_view's=20
capabilities. Such is the power and magnificence of array_view!=20

Supporting a dynamic bitset would require some additional logic to handle=
=20
growing via push_back(). It probably needs to be its own class. Also I'm=20
not sure I see a value having a dynamic_bitset_view over a std::vector? Do=
=20
you have a use case for that?
=20

> In this way you could make the old bitset a simple typedef (given that th=
e=20
> current proposal would
> break the ABI anyway, why not?), but you could also leave bitset alone,=
=20
> not breaking the ABI in any way,=20
> and let users that need more power to use bitset_view over whichever=20
> container they like.
>
> What do you think about this idea?
>
> Bye,
> Nicola
>

Probably we want separate bitset (std::array), dynamic_bitset=20
(std::vector), and bitset_view (std::array_view).
